Eco-Friendly Getaways and Sustainable Accommodations at East End Long Island

As sustainable travel gains momentum, more travelers are searching for eco-friendly accommodations on Long Island’s East End. Where are the best spots that combine comfort and a minimal environmental footprint? Have you come across any unique or hidden gems? Here are a few notable examples:

  • Rose Hill Vineyards (Mattituck): A vineyard with sustainable practices, offering organic wine tours and eco-conscious accommodations
  • The Quogue Club at Hallock House (Quogue): Many bed and breakfasts on the East End are adopting green initiatives, such as energy-efficient lighting, recycling programs, and the use of locally sourced, organic ingredients.
  • Catapano Dairy Farm (Peconic): A farm stay offering organic products and a glimpse into sustainable farming.
